Local Weather Risks in Princeton

πŸŒͺ️

Triggers

Common triggers: - Extreme heat (100Β°F+) overloading AC units - Ice and freezes damaging outdoor coils - Thunderstorms causing power surges - High humidity promoting rapid mold growth

πŸ“…

Seasonal Risks

HVAC emergencies spike in summer (June-September) from heat overloads and in winter (December-February) from freezes in North Texas. High demand strains systems during these peaks.

🏚️

Disaster Scenarios

Post-storm power surges can fry components. Flooding from heavy rains may short electrical parts. Prepare by having systems inspected before severe weather.

Emergency Prevention Tips

  • βœ“ Replace air filters every 1-3 months
  • βœ“ Annual professional inspections before peak seasons
  • βœ“ Clear debris around outdoor units regularly
  • βœ“ Install and test carbon monoxide detectors yearly
  • βœ“ Seal duct leaks to improve efficiency

❓ What is considered an HVAC emergency?

True emergencies include no heat/cool in extreme weather, gas leaks, or fire risks. Routine tune-ups are not emergencies.

❓ How quickly will help arrive in Princeton?

Local specialists aim for 1-2 hour response in urgent cases. Factors like traffic or weather may affect timing.

❓ What if I smell gas from my furnace?

Evacuate immediately, call 911 first, then emergency HVAC. Do not use switches or flames.
